Few street racing crashes manage to look sillier than the one we're here to discuss, with a Lamborghini Aventador SV Roadster having recently been involved in such an accident, which took place in central London.
The Superveloce Roadster, which was reportedly being driven by a 20-year-old student, was racing a Bentley Continental GT at the time of the crash, as you can see in the video at the bottom of the page.

The footage brings what can be described as a typical street racing scenario, with the Lambo and the Bentley taunting each other while going from one traffic light to another.

Despite the Superveloce's obviously superior sprinting abilities, its driver seems to switch into the wrong gear (keep in mind that we're dealing with a paddle shift gearbox), which temporarily leads to the Conti getting ahead.

The 750 hp Raging Bull eventually passes the Crewe Grand Tourer and, despite apparently having plenty of room in front of it, doesn't manage to stop in time. As such, the Aventador SV Roadster rear-ends a Vauxhall Astra and a Mercedes-Benz S-Class that were waiting for the traffic light in front of the Lambo to turn green.

While we have no official details on how the accident took place, the action in the clip leads us to believe the young driver of the Aventador SV Roadster got distracted after passing the Bentley and thus didn't use the full deceleration abilities of the carbon fiber brakes until it was too late.

The impact was rather serious, causing hefty damage to all three vehicles. As far as the Lamborghini was concerned, the rollover bars of the Roadsters were activated, as you'll be able to see in the post-crash Instagram picture below.

Perhaps the only positive side of this story comes from the police report following the accident, which states nobody was injured in the crash.
